NA-Technical Paper 01-04 September 2004
This report describes forest disturbances and conditions for a 20-state region that constitutes the administrative region of the Northeastern Area, State and Private Forestry, USDA Forest Service. The constituent States are Connecticut, Delaware, Illinois, Indiana, Iowa, Maine, Maryland, Massachusetts, Michigan, Minnesota, Missouri, New Hampshire, New Jersey, New York, Ohio, Pennsylvania, Rhode Island, Vermont, West Virginia, and Wisconsin.
